Property Details for 11 Heytesbury Cres, Craigieburn

11 Heytesbury Cres, Craigieburn is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1999. The property has a land size of 654m2 and floor size of 166m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 2022.

Last Listing description (October 2022)

With unobstructed views of the twelfth fairway, this stunning Federation-look family home occupies a quiet position on a tree-lined street with no through-traffic.

Located in one of Craigieburn's super-affluent pockets, the supersized Hotondo open-plan entertainer boasts bright and airy living spaces, palatial private retreats, fully-equipped kitchen, stylish bathrooms, warm timber-look flooring, plush carpeting, contemporary colour palettes, gymnasium and grand-designed outdoor living that will blow you away.


Occupying a sunny 654sqm, walk the kids to Pembroke Crescent Reserve plus a short car ride to Craigieburn Golf Club, Craigieburn South Primary School, Our Lady's Catholic Primary School, Aitken Hill Primary School, Craigieburn Central, Waterside Caf, and Craigieburn Station.

Fringed by manicured gardens, established lawn and decorative trees, an immaculate exterior leads through to an expansive formal living/dining zone and Coonara gas log fireplace. To the left of the entryway is your oversized primary bedroom suite, with large picture windows and garden outlook comprising a walk-in robe and polished ensuite.

The additional bedrooms contain built-ins and are complemented by a family-sized bathroom, including a six-jet spa bath, separate shower, and separate toilet.

Looking out onto greenery, the luminous kitchen/family zone is warm and intimate.

Efficient storage systems, abundant bench space, modern appliances, and high-end fixtures and fittings are a feature of the kitchen.

But this home's centre of attention and what sets it apart from other homes on the market today, is your awe-inspiring alfresco and outdoor area. Outstandingly spacious, the enormous, pitched pergola spans an expansive courtyard comprising multiple seating options, timber decking, stamped concrete flooring, and an exquisite, redgum built-in barbecue.

Perfectly positioned to soak-up the natural-look garden and golf course beyond, the semi-enclosed alfresco protects its occupants from the wind and invites instant relaxation. This space can be accessed from three different points: hallway, family room, and garage.

The landscaped backyard is highly functional for both children and adults making it the ultimate in outdoor entertainment. An extended double remote garage is currently set-up as a gym boasting abundant cabinet storage.

Other highlights include a large laundry, property side access and storage area, gas ducted heating, evaporative cooling, 3500-litre water tanks, and a Colorbond shed.

About Craigieburn 3064

The size of Craigieburn is approximately 35.5 square kilometres. It has 100 parks covering nearly 10.4% of total area. The population of Craigieburn in 2011 was 32,756 people. By 2016 the population was 50,364 showing a population growth of 53.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Craigieburn is 30-39 years. Households in Craigieburn are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Craigieburn work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 78.8% of the homes in Craigieburn were owner-occupied compared with 69.4% in 2016.

Craigieburn has 25,773 properties.
